What is Imperium® Deep Restoration?

Imperium® Deep Restoration is a facial rejuvenation treatment that uses the Imperium Med 400 system. This treats the skin with diathermy to promote the production of collagen, elastin, and hyaluronic acid to improve skin quality. It also involves microneedling fractional RF to remodel the dermis for true and lasting skin rejuvenation.

How does the treatment work?

Imperium® Deep Restoration uses different technologies to cleanse, repair, and nourish the skin, as well as address signs of aging. It combines the use of:

Sonoblade 25– This uses the elastic wave (low-frequency ultrasound 25kHz) technology to send a series of vibrations to the skin. Mainly for water peeling and drug infusion, Sonoblade 25 can exfoliate the skin’s most superficial layer to increase skin permeability and blood supply. Other benefits include:

  • Hydration
  • Bacterial sterilisation
  • Stimulation of skin cell turnover
  • Get rid of superficial dark spots
  • Sonophoresis

Fractional Pulsed Crown RF – The handpiece’s tip creates 125 micro holes in the skin’s outer layers and emits pulsed radiofrequency energy. This then causes thermal stimulation of the dermis, which along with the mechanical action of perforation, results in a series of skin benefits and advantages. These include:

  • Collagen remodelling
  • Preserving the skin’s superficial layers, as it targets the deep layers of the dermis
  • Tissue regeneration in a natural manner
  • No downtime; does not require recovery time

What can you expect with the treatment?

With Imperium® Deep Restoration, you can achieve true skin rejuvenation without going under the knife. As it can stimulate collagen and regenerate tissues, you can expect to see improvements in skin tone and texture, as well as signs of aging. 

Keep in mind that the growth or production of new collagen is not immediate. You will need to wait 2 to 4 months. The treatment can provide you not with dramatic skin firming effects, but noticeable and natural-looking results.
